Assessment and Detection
First, our technicians use thermal imaging and moisture meters to find the leak. It’s not just about where the water is. It’s about where the damage is. We check for hidden moisture behind walls and under floors. This step takes 1-2 hours. But it’s critical. Without it, we can’t fix the problem. And that’s not a smart move. Don’t skip this step. It’s the first part of the solution.
Water Extraction
We use industrial pumps and wet vacuums to remove standing water. This happens quickly. Within a few hours. We target all affected areas. Including under the slab. It’s not just about what you see. It’s about what’s hidden. This step takes 2-4 hours depending on the size of the leak. But it’s necessary. And it’s the best way to prevent mold. You don’t want to wait. The longer the water stays, the worse it gets.
Drying and Dehumidification
We set up air movers and dehumidifiers to dry out affected materials. This process takes 3-5 days. We monitor moisture levels every 12 hours. It’s not a race. It’s about making sure everything dries completely. We use IICRC certified equipment. And we track progress. This step is critical. Without it, you risk mold and long-term damage. Slab Leak Water Removal Cost In Dedham, MA
Slab leak water removal costs vary. It depends on the severity of the leak, the size of the affected area, and the materials involved. These are general estimates. And they’re not guarantees. It’s best to get a free on-site assessment. That way, you know exactly what to expect. And you can plan accordingly. It’s a smart move. And it’s the best way to avoid surprises.
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Initial assessment and detection | $100 – $300 | Complexity of the leak and the tools needed. |
| Water extraction | $500 – $1,200 | Amount of water and how deep it’s trapped. |
| Drying and dehumidification | $800 – $2,000 | Size of the area and moisture levels. |
| Repair and restoration | $1,000 – $5,000 | Extent of damage and materials needed. |
| Final inspection and documentation | $200 – $500 | Detail and clarity of the report. |
| Insurance claim help | Free | Our team handles the process with your carrier. |
